Earlier this year, we spoke to Byron, Kara and Wendy, three of our adult learners, who all studied our GCSE Maths evening course.

They spoke of their College experience, why they came back to education, and what surprised them about being back in education.

We caught up again with them recently, where they spoke about how studying as an adult at EKC Sheppey College has changed their life.

We’re pleased to see that all three passed GCSE Maths, with the entire adult learning cohort for GCSE Maths securing a pass (Grade 4 or above).

Read what they had to say below:


Byron – Grade 4:

How did you feel collecting your results?

“I didn’t feel the most confident I must admit as I’m not really a confident person anyway, but it was way better than I thought so I couldn’t be more pleased.”

What are you looking to do next?

“I may even go onto GCSE English, because doing this course and passing this course has given me the confidence that I can do it. I never in a million years would have thought that I could do this, and now look at me. It’s great.”

How has the support been?

“It’s been exceptional, I couldn’t have asked for better support really. I think Christine, our lecturer, understood that we only really had eight months to do it, compressed from a two-year course. She understood that and her lesson plans were perfect in accommodating that.”

What’s your advice for a future student?

“Do it, even if you think you can’t do it or you’re not capable, or you were rubbish at school, like I was. I couldn’t do it but look at where I’m at now. I’ve got a Grade 4 and I’ve done it. Again, never in a million years did I think I could do it. If I can do it, you can do it.”


Kara – Grade 4:

How does it feel to pass?

“It feels amazing, I can’t really put it into words or even explain how relieved I feel.”

How has the support been?

“It’s been great, I can’t fault any of my lecturers. They’re happy, they’re supportive, they really want what is best for you and it shows, it shines through.”

What are you hoping to do now?

“Now that I have my GCSE Maths, I’m going onto GCSE English, as it’s a teaching degree that I’m after. Obviously, I didn’t do well the first time round when I was at school, but now I’m working harder, I’ll put my GCSEs behind me and then go to university.”

What’s your advice for a future student?

“Revise! I didn’t do as much as I could have, but I put the effort in and I passed. Make sure you also believe in yourself.”


Wendy – Grade 5:

How does it feel to have passed GCSE Maths?

“It feels amazing to have passed, because I never took my GCSEs when I was at school all those years ago, and I never thought I could again, so the fact that I got a 5 makes me absolutely thrilled.”

How did you feel about collecting the results?

“I felt very excited coming in. I didn’t bother with the nerves as it was already done and the result was determined, but I was excited to come here and collect them in-person. I didn’t experience GCSEs at all, so I didn’t know what to expect.”

How do you feel the staff have supported you?

“I felt really supported during my studies at College. I used to get encouraging emails when I needed help as well as being in the class itself surrounded by other adults. There’s lots of support.”

What advice do you have for future students?

“That’s a tricky one! I would apply myself and make sure that I did at least half an hour every day of Maths, but if you can put a certain amount of time aside and stick to it then it really does help. The time you put into it really does reap rewards.”
